I recently had the battery of my S80 replaced. The car was dead one
day and after getting the new battery I thought everything was fine,
until about a week later the car was dead again. Now this seems to
happen at least once a week, and the car has to be jump started. Does
anybody know if this is an alternator problem, or am I missing
something? Also, some interior lights and the sunroof is not
working. I have already checked the fuses, so those are good. Thanks
in advance for any help.

Today, I found the source problem to the whole electrical issue. I
had the battery replaced at a local Wal-Mart and noticed yesterday
that the ground cable from the negative terminal of the battery to the
frame was loose. Apparently, the tech had loosened the bolt holding
the cable to the frame. This bolt is not clearly visible when looking
in the trunk, but after tightening, there have not been any more
problems as of yet. I returned the alternator, and have hopefully
fixed the problem. I guess that is what I get for taking it to Wal-
Mart. Should have known better!!
